Irish PubShow at the Main Square of Szombathely – Bloomsday

 

James Joyce wrote about the odyssey of the modern man of the street (Ulysses), the story of a simple weekday of Dublin: 16th of June, 1904. People in Dublin remember this day since the 1950s, they replay the events of that day, from the early morning happenings to the all-day roaming. According to the novel, Szombathely is the hero: the native town of Leopold Bloom. Bloomsday of Szombathely was first organized in 1994, and since then it is replayed from year to year.
